Transaction 28f097064c63d6bdb50eebf9285da82a9916d97282e7e92223764e3832dcaa7e

1 Input
2 Outputs
  • 28f097064c63d6bdb50eebf9285da82a9916d97282e7e92223764e3832dcaa7e:0
  • value  2836880
    address  3KzeuAkynQpn3AePw6bYABbPn3yFtmWiJL
  • 28f097064c63d6bdb50eebf9285da82a9916d97282e7e92223764e3832dcaa7e:1
  • value  187621269
    address  1Fz975MjdEwQP9DovgEu59jod7y1sf7gQZ